Feature bejahen bemalen
Definition seine Zustimmung geben; ja sagen mit Malereien verzieren, dekorieren

Spelling & Dictionary Insight

A purely visual mix-up. bejahen ([bəˈjaːən]) and bemalen ([bəˈmaːlən])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one. On the page they stay close: they share most of their letters but differ in 2 positions.
